About Willard C. Johnson

Willard C. Johnson is a scholar working on Surgery,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Internal Medicine and Hepatology, having authored 66 papers that have together received 2.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Peripheral Artery Disease Management (20 papers), Vascular Procedures and Complications (12 papers), Aortic aneurysm repair treatments (9 papers), Venous Thromboembolism Diagnosis and Management (8 papers), Liver Disease and Transplantation (8 papers), Appendicitis Diagnosis and Management (6 papers), Pancreatitis Pathology and Treatment (5 papers) and Diabetic Foot Ulcer Assessment and Management (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Internal Medicine (216 citations), Surgery (2.0k citations), Emergency Medicine (384 cit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(999 citations) and Hepatology (179 citations). Willard C. Johnson has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Pakistan. Frequent co-authors include Donald C. Nabseth, Alan H. Robbins, Stephen G. Gerzof, Warren C. Widrich, William O. Williford, Desmond H. Birkett, Stuart J. Spechler, Peter A. Banks, Steven M. Wetzner and Michael Jay. Their work appears in journals such as The American Journal of Surgery, Journal of Vascular Surgery, Annals of Surgery, Journal of Surgical Research and Gastroenterology.
